This Rockets team is better as well though. That team 5 years ago still had Steve Francis playing at point guard, with Yao only in his second year, and nobody at the small forward comparing to the Artest/Battier combo. I think a likely result is they put a scare at Lakers in one of the first two games, win game 3 and 5, and loses game 6 probably by double digits.

Oh Pierce. What were you thinking? If you let Noah go what's the worst that happens, the Bulls go up by two? Instead you want to make him earn them from the line and sacrifice yourself? Heads up play there Pierce.

This has been a very good series, but sweet fuckin' christ no one wants it. That's what's keeping this from being a great series in my book. Yes there have been seven overtimes in six games and that makes for great theater, but the quality of basketball going on here is verging on pathetic. The Bulls blow a 10+ lead in Boston. The Celtics return the favor two nights later. No one knows how to play a full 48.

The Celtics could've easily have won this series in a sweep, and just as easily the Bulls could've won in five. No one wants it. Someone's going to have to take it on Saturday and I really like the Celtics chances. They're at home, they'll get the calls, Pierce will redeem himself, Allen's going to have another good night (20+), and Rondo is going to take the ball to the hoop.
